find a polynomial of degree 3 with zeros of 4, 2i and -2i

Sagot :

[tex](x-4)(x-2i)(x+2i)=\\ (x-4)(x^2+4)=\\ x^3+4x-4x^2-16=\\ x^3-4x^2+4x-16[/tex]
